Output 5212d34644c0217dec6b4bfc71b2ee37a2ae9f88e0844c96cae9e43acc1bd2bc:27

value
99698476
script pubkey
OP_0 OP_PUSHBYTES_32 c5c0998995e72a85a1cf7ccf46f1d90f93fab726a2b9abc73acac5f263ea2e2f
address
bc1qchqfnzv4uu4gtgw00n85duwep7fl4dex52u6h3e6etzlycl29chsc4z955
transaction
5212d34644c0217dec6b4bfc71b2ee37a2ae9f88e0844c96cae9e43acc1bd2bc